The Kettlebell Alternating Renegade Row is a compound exercise that combines core stability with upper body strength. It targets the muscles of the back, arms, and core while challenging balance and coordination. This exercise is beneficial for building functional strength and enhancing core stability.
How to do it
- Start in a plank position with a kettlebell in each hand under your shoulders.
- Engage your core and row one kettlebell toward your ribcage, keeping your elbow close.
- Lower the kettlebell back to the ground and switch sides, maintaining a steady plank.
- Alternate arms, keeping your body straight without rotating your hips.
- Focus on using your back muscles to lift the weight rather than your arms.
